Recent work showed that arterial compliance may be elevated unexpectedly in obese children, attributable to accelerated growth and maturation. We hypothesize that children with obesity or Type 2 diabetes may reach peak arterial maturation earlier in life and then experience an earlier, and potentially more rapid, decline in arterial compliance, leading toward earlier cardiovascular disease development.
